Top Attractions & Must-Visit Places in Monastir, Tunisia
- Ribat of Monastir: This iconic fortress, perched on a cliff overlooking the sea, is a must-see. Explore its history, soak in the views, and imagine life centuries ago.
- Bourguiba Mausoleum: A stunning mausoleum dedicated to Habib Bourguiba, Tunisia's first president. The architecture is breathtaking, and it's a significant site for understanding Tunisian history.
- Monastir Beach: Relax, unwind, and soak up the Mediterranean sun on Monastir's beautiful beaches. Perfect for a swim, sunbathe, or just chilling out.
- The Medina: Get lost in the charming alleyways of the medina, a traditional Arab market. Bargain for souvenirs, sample local delicacies, and experience the authentic heart of Monastir.

Eat Like a Local: Must-Try Foods in Monastir, Tunisia
- Couscous: A staple dish, often served with meat or vegetables.
- Briks: Savoury pastries filled with tuna, eggs, or vegetables.
- Tajine: A slow-cooked stew, usually with meat and vegetables.
- Fresh Seafood: Monastir's coastal location makes it a great place to enjoy fresh seafood.

When’s the Best Time to Go?
The best time to visit Monastir is during spring (April-May) or autumn (September-October) for pleasant weather and fewer crowds. Summer (June-August) is hot and busy, while winter (November-March) can be cool and wet.
